Mr David Trimble
Lady Hermon
Mr Roy Beggs

2

*Clause     5,     page     4,     line     4,     leave out from beginning to end of line 5 on page 5 and insert—

    '(1)   The Secretary of State may, having regard to any report of the Monitoring Commission, any relevant proceedings in the Assembly and any other relevant matter, if he is satisfied that a Minister or a junior Minister is not committed to non-violence and exclusively peaceful and democratic means, or has failed to observe any other terms of the pledge of office, by direction exclude the Minister or junior Minister from holding office as a Minister or junior Minister for such period of not less than three months and not more than twelve months beginning with the date of the direction as the direction may provide.

    (2)   The Secretary of State may, having regard to any report of the Monitoring Commission, any relevant proceedings in the Assembly and any other relevant matter, if he is satisfied that a political party is not committed to non-violence and exclusively peaceful and democratic means, or is not committed to such of its members as are or might become Ministers or junior Ministers observing the other terms of the pledge of office, by direction exclude members of the political party concerned from holding office as a Minister or junior Minister for such period of not less than six months and not more than twelve months beginning with the date of the direction as the direction may provide.

    (3)   The Secretary of State may, having regard to any relevant proceedings in the Assembly, before any period of exclusion comes to an end extend it for a further period, in the case of an exclusion under section 30(1) or subsection (1) of this section of not less than three months and not more than twelve months, or in the case of an exclusion under section 30(2) or subsection (2) of this section for a further period of not less than six months and not more than than twelve months, if he is satisfied that the Minister, junior Minister or political party, as the case may be, is not committed to non-violence and exclusively peaceful and democratic means, or is not committed to observance of the terms of the pledge of office.'.
